23. How to Use Offset
[Description]
If you want to move (offset) all teaching points by several millimeters because the actuator was displaced
at the time of installation, etc., you can use an OFST command to specify an offset for position data.
You can also use an OFST command to perform pitch feed operation. (Refer to 25, “Constant Pitch Feed
Operation.”)
[Note]
Once an offset is set, the offset will apply to all movement commands. To cancel the offset, issue an
OFST command again by setting 0 mm. The offset will not be reflected in other programs (even in the
multi-tasking mode). If the offset must be applied to all programs, it must be set separately in each
program.
